标题:链上交易和链下交易有什么区别?链上交易和链下交易区别介绍(链上交易和链下交易概念)
文章:
链上交易和链下交易是区块链技术中两个重要的交易概念,它们在交易流程、安全性、效率等方面存在显著差异。以下是关于链上交易和链下交易的区别介绍。
一、链上交易
链上交易是指在区块链网络上进行的交易,所有交易数据都会被永久记录在区块链上,具有去中心化、不可篡改的特点。以下是链上交易的一些特点:
1. 去中心化:链上交易不依赖于任何中心化的机构或第三方,交易双方直接在区块链上进行交互。
2. 透明性:所有链上交易数据都公开可查,任何人都可以查看交易记录。
3. 安全性:区块链技术具有强大的加密算法,链上交易安全性较高。
4. 不可篡改:一旦交易数据被记录在区块链上,就无法被修改或删除。
二、链下交易
链下交易是指在区块链网络之外进行的交易,交易双方通过传统的支付方式(如银行转账、电子支付等)完成交易。以下是链下交易的一些特点:
1. 中心化:链下交易依赖于中心化的金融机构或第三方支付平台。
2. 不透明:交易双方之间的交易细节通常不会公开。
3. 安全性相对较低:链下交易可能存在被欺诈、篡改等风险。
4. 效率较高:链下交易通常比链上交易更快捷,因为不需要等待区块链网络的确认。
三、链上交易和链下交易的区别
1. 交易流程:链上交易需要通过区块链网络进行,而链下交易则依赖于传统支付方式。
2. 安全性:链上交易安全性较高,而链下交易可能存在安全隐患。
3. 透明度:链上交易具有高度的透明度,而链下交易通常不透明。
4. 效率:链下交易效率较高,链上交易则可能因为网络拥堵而效率较低。
总结:
链上交易和链下交易在交易流程、安全性、透明度和效率等方面存在明显差异。在实际应用中,根据具体需求和场景选择合适的交易方式至关重要。
常见问题清单:
1. 链上交易和链下交易的区别是什么?
2. 链上交易的安全性如何?
3. 链下交易的优势是什么?
4. 链上交易和链下交易在效率上有什么不同?
5. 为什么链上交易具有去中心化的特点?
6. 链下交易的数据是否公开?
7. 链上交易和链下交易的成本差异?
8. 链上交易如何保证数据不可篡改?
9. 链下交易可能面临哪些风险?
10. 如何在区块链项目中选择合适的交易方式?
详细解答:
1. 链上交易和链下交易的区别主要在于交易流程、安全性、透明度和效率等方面。链上交易在区块链上进行,具有去中心化、不可篡改、透明等特点;链下交易则依赖于传统支付方式,可能存在安全隐患和不透明的问题。
2. 链上交易的安全性较高,因为区块链技术具有强大的加密算法,交易数据被永久记录在链上,难以被篡改。
3. 链下交易的优势在于效率较高,交易过程通常比链上交易更快,而且成本可能较低。
4. 链上交易可能因为网络拥堵而效率较低,而链下交易则通常更快。
5. 链上交易具有去中心化的特点,因为交易数据由网络中的所有节点共同维护,无需依赖中心化机构。
6. 链下交易的数据通常不公开,除非交易双方自愿公开。
7. 链上交易的成本可能包括交易手续费和交易确认时间等,而链下交易的成本可能包括支付平台的费用等。
8. 链上交易通过区块链的加密算法和共识机制保证数据不可篡改。
9. 链下交易可能面临的风险包括交易对手风险、支付平台风险、法律法规风险等。
10. 在选择合适的交易方式时,应考虑交易的安全性、效率、成本和适用场景等因素,根据具体需求进行选择。